In a research study conducted at Fitzsimons Army Medical Facility to much better understand the impact of nurses' deal with their psychological health, it was discovered that registered nurses in adverse work settings with greater job pressure experienced greater emotional fatigue. On the other hand, nurses who obtained support from their supervisors experienced considerably reduced emotional exhaustion, highlighting the significance of helpful leadership in advertising staff member mental wellness (Constable & Russell, 1986).

The amusing feature of a teacher's workplace hours is that pupils do not normally come by until completion of the semester when last grades schedule. Nonetheless, when I developed and showed a training course on youth trauma throughout my first year at Howard College in 2015, the line outside my workplace swiftly grew longer and much longer Read Full Report as the semester progressed.
A common greeting became, "Hi, Dr. Mance. I was thinking regarding what you claimed in course, and I think I need to speak to somebody." Students' requests to satisfy with me extended beyond my minimal workplace hours. At the end of class, they would certainly align before my desk or stroll with me to my following visit.

Much of the concentrate on mental wellness has actually shifted from pathology to awareness and self-care.
Younger generations are a lot more singing concerning psychological health, especially on social media sites. Personal stories are currently extra public than they have remained in the past, which helps in reducing stigma. Television shows, podcasts, social media and open conversations, along with a wealth of medical research study, have actually helped to shift the conversation and awareness of psychological health and wellness in a positive instructions.
